Ceisteanna—Questions. Oral Answers. - Expense of Maintaining Border.

asked the Minister for Finance if he will furnish for the last three years, or the latest date for which figures are available, the annual expenditure which is involved in maintaining the Border, including the outlay necessary for the prevention of smuggling.

To furnish a complete answer to this question would require addressing inquiries to a number of Government Departments affected by the existence of the Border, and would involve an amount of detailed labour and research which I am quite certain that the Deputy would, on reflection, agree to be quite out of proportion to the practical value of any figures arrived at.
